What is recorded here

Located beneath the motte (ME008-032002-) and entered at the south. It consists of a drystone-built and lintelled passage (Wth of base 1m; Wth of top 0.7m; H 1.3m)) that curves to the E (L c. 20m), and it is collapsed at its further end. The above description is derived from the published 'Archaeological Inventory of County Meath' (Dublin: Stationery Office, 1987). In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research. Compiled by : Michael Moore Date of upload: 31 October 2018
